Rationale & Objectives Primary aldosteronism (PA) is underdiagnosed in people living with hypertension, despite its considerable prevalence, association with poorer cardiovascular and kidney outcomes, and availability of effective treatment. The factors underlying such underdiagnosis and undertreatment remain uncertain. This study aimed to identify key factors influencing screening, diagnosis and treatment of PA from the clinician’s perspective. Study Design Exploratory qualitative study. Setting and Participants Thirty-eight clinicians were recruited from across Australia, including cardiologists (n = 8), endocrinologists (n = 10), general practitioners (n = 10) and nephrologists (n = 10). Purposive sampling achieved diversity in practice location, setting, and clinical experience. In-depth semistructured interviews were conducted between May and November 2024. Analytical Approach Interview transcripts were analyzed using both deductive content analysis aligned with the Consolidated Framework for Implementation Research and inductive reflexive thematic analysis. Results Four themes were developed to explain factors affecting clinician screening, diagnosis, and treatment decisions: (1) Clinician experience, knowledge, and perceptions; (2) PA screening and diagnosis complexity and burden; (3) accessibility of services and information; and (4) health system, government, and organizational factors. Common barriers across clinician groups included that PA is often considered in a narrow patient cohort, with older and comorbid populations not considered candidates for screening; that the perceived complexity and burden associated with PA diagnosis inhibits initiation of the diagnostic process; that limited access to services is a barrier to screening or workup of PA; and that lack of streamlined and local diagnostic services contributes to fragmented care and diagnostic delay. Key facilitators included access to specialized diagnostic units and cross-disciplinary and collegial decision making in patient management. Limitations Generalizability may be limited due to Australian context. Conclusions These findings highlight key factors that influence clinicians’ decision making in PA detection and management, providing important guidance to the design of future clinician-targeted interventions to improve PA diagnosis and treatment. Plain-Language Summary Primary aldosteronism (PA) is the most common hormonal cause of hypertension; however, it is vastly underdiagnosed and often suboptimally managed. The basis for this is poorly understood. To explore this, nephrologists, endocrinologists, cardiologists, and general practitioners were interviewed to understand their decision making in PA management. Major barriers included: often only narrow profiles of patients were considered candidates for PA screening; the diagnostic process was perceived as burdensome and therefore often not initiated; and that limited diagnostic service access dictated clinical management and contributed to diagnostic delay. Conversely, specialized diagnostic units and professional networks promoted optimal patient management. These findings highlight key factors that can be leveraged in the design of future clinician-targeted interventions to improve PA care.
INTRODUCTION:The Primary Care Assessment Tool (PCAT) is designed to assess a patient's experience with primary care across various core and ancillary domains, including First contact - Utilization, First contact - Access, Ongoing Care, Coordination, Comprehensiveness (services provided), Family-centeredness, Community Orientation, and Cultural Competence. This study examined the psychometric properties of the Adult Primary Care Assessment Tool Short Form (PCAT-S) in the Australian general practice setting. METHOD:Data included 715 participants from the EQuIP-GP study, a cluster randomized controlled trial (RCT) conducted with adults aged 18-65 years with a chronic illness or aged over 65 years, from 34 general practices across Australia. For each subscale we assessed internal consistency using Cronbach's alpha. Factor structure of the PCAT-S instrument was assessed through confirmatory and exploratory factor analysis, using three samples with different methods for handling 'don't know/can't remember' responses. RESULTS:The findings were mixed. Specifically, the subscales related to First Contact - Utilization, Ongoing Care and Comprehensiveness, demonstrated satisfactory internal consistency. However, the remaining subscales showed weak internal consistency. Confirmatory factor analysis indicated potential model misspecification, while exploratory factor analysis generally supported the hypothesized factor structure, albeit with some observed deviations. CONCLUSIONS:The findings indicate the PCAT-S shows promise as an instrument to evaluate primary care experiences in Australia. However, the observed variability in internal consistency, along with issues identified in confirmatory and exploratory factor analyses, highlight the need for further validation and refinement in this population. Further research is required to address the identified limitations and enhance the tool's applicability within the Australian general practice context.
OBJECTIVE:Appropriate intervals for repeat (surveillance) colonoscopy are important for early colorectal cancer detection and treatment, timely patient access, and minimising patient risks. This study aimed to assess the concordance of endoscopist-recommended surveillance colonoscopy intervals with those recommended by the 2018 Australian Cancer Council surveillance colonoscopy guidelines. METHODS:Three metropolitan and three rural public hospitals in Victoria, Australia, each retrospectively audited at least 35 consecutive colonoscopy cases where the outcome recommendation was for future surveillance. The audit covered colonoscopies conducted between April 2020 and June 2021. Nurses at each hospital audited colonoscopy reports, histopathology results and other relevant patient documentation. Audit data were used to calculate the guideline-interval, which was compared with the endoscopist-recommended return interval to determine concordance. RESULTS:Of 465 consecutive colonoscopy cases audited, 248 were recommended for future surveillance colonoscopy and had complete data. A total of 25.4% (63/248) had an endoscopist-recommended interval that was consistent with the guidelines. Among discordant cases, 74.6% (n = 138) of recommendations were early; 20.5% (n = 38) were not indicated and 4.9% (n = 9) were late according to the guidelines. Excluding cases that should not return for surveillance (n = 38), concordance by guideline-recommended interval categories was 66.7% (8/12) for cases with an interval of ≤12 months, 31.0% (13/42) for 3 years, 58.3% (42/72) for 5 years and 0.0% (0/84) for 10 years. CONCLUSIONS:Guideline concordance was suboptimal at participating hospitals. Most discordant surveillance interval recommendations made were earlier than the guidelines recommend. An active, tailored approach to implementation is required given the lack of uptake several years after guideline introduction.
Background Primary care research capacity is hindered by fragmented systems, limited protected clinician time, and poorly developed pathways for translating evidence into practice. The Translating Research Outcomes into the Primary Health Interface (TROPHI) initiative was established in outer Eastern Melbourne, Australia, to address these challenges by strengthening regional research capacity, fostering collaboration between primary care and academic sectors, and supporting research translation. TROPHI was funded by Windermere Foundation. Aim To evaluate the implementation and early impact of TROPHI, focusing on its ability to build interdisciplinary networks, enhance research capacity, and facilitate primary care research. Design & setting Our hybrid evaluation was set in outer Eastern Melbourne, Australia Method Our evaluation was informed by Cooke’s framework for research capacity development and the Consolidated Framework for Implementation Research (CFIR). We analysed study documents and conducted semi-structured interviews with 29 TROPHI staff, award recipients, partners, consumers, and funders. Results TROPHI established a regional interdisciplinary network and created accessible entry points into research for clinicians through mentorship, bursaries, fellowships, and seed funding. Participants reported increased research skills, confidence, and engagement, alongside early examples of translation into practice. Over three years, TROPHI leveraged an initial AUD$1M philanthropic investment into more than AUD$3M in competitive grants. Implementation was supported by established organisational partnerships but required substantial contributions from staff at lead organisations. Conclusion TROPHI strengthened primary care research capacity by fostering partnerships and supporting clinicians, generating regional momentum. It represents a promising model for regional capacity building. Sustained impact will require ongoing investment, broader workforce engagement, and stronger integration with systems.
OBJECTIVES:This study aimed to investigate the impact of 'who' delivers a health message (general practitioner or community representative), and the 'visual stimulus' (animation or talking head) used on influencing attitudes toward safe behaviours in the context of the COVID-19 pandemic, across six vulnerable population subgroups STUDY DESIGN: A 'helix' randomised controlled trial with 2x2 factorial design. METHODS:Participants (40 per subgroup) were randomly allocated within their subgroup to an intervention sequence. They completed a factorial, counter-balanced allocation of four intervention combinations across four safe behaviour contexts. Exposure to each intervention was followed by online survey questions investigating intention to undertake, and encourage family and friends to undertake, the context-specific behaviour using a 5-point Likert-style scale RESULTS: A total of 358 participants responded to requests to participate in the study, of whom 298 (83%) fully completed and 58 (16%) partially completed surveys. Participants were more likely to report higher intention to perform COVID-safe behaviours when exposed to animation compared to talking head visual stimuli (Coef = -0·12, 95% CI = -0·22 to -0·01, p = 0·03; β = -0.12, 95% CI -0.22 to -0.01, p = .03, animation > talking head) There was no main effect of 'who' provided the message; however, several interaction effects were noted across population subgroups for each intervention. CONCLUSION:The approach best suited for different vulnerable subgroups varies across each, indicating a one-size-fits-all approach should not be used and is inequitable. However, the additional costs and time-delays that would be encountered in preparing subgroup-specific materials also warrant consideration.
BACKGROUND:Extracorporeal membrane oxygenation (ECMO) is a complex, costly, and uncommon life-saving treatment for critically ill patients with severe cardiac and/or respiratory failure in intensive care units, though its use has increased in recent years. Survivors frequently experience long-term physical, cognitive, and psychological challenges and require support from a wide range of healthcare providers and facilities, many of whom may have limited experience with ECMO. Timely and comprehensive discharge communication is essential to ensure continuity and quality of care across settings. OBJECTIVES:The aims of this study were to assess the proportion of patients treated with ECMO who had a documented primary care physician or clinic on file and to evaluate the inclusion of clinical information in their hospital discharge summaries. METHODS:This multi-centre retrospective observational study included adults treated with ECMO and discharged alive from four tertiary hospitals between January 1, 2021, and December 31, 2022. Patients who died in hospital or were transferred to another acute facility were excluded. Data were collected through medical records' review and linkage with the EXCEL Registry. RESULTS:Of the 150 participants who met eligibility criteria (mean age: 48 years, 72.7% male), 126 (84%) had a documented primary care physician or clinic. Among the 148 (98.7%) medical discharge summaries, the primary diagnosis was recorded for all participants, ECMO use was recorded for 147 (99.3%) participants, discharge destination for 142 (95.9%), hospital follow-up plans for 136 (91.9%), and ECMO indications for 135 (91.2%). Discharge medications were recorded in 131 (88.5%) cases, and a hospital contact person was provided in 95 (64.2%) cases. In contrast, intensive care unit-specific and ECMO-specific recommendations were reported in only 23 (15.5%) and 8 (5.4%) summaries, respectively. CONCLUSIONS:These findings highlight the need to improve discharge communication to better support primary care physicians in delivering coordinated care following hospital discharge.
BACKGROUND:Older adults from culturally and linguistically diverse backgrounds often face communication barriers in general practice, which compromise care quality and patient safety. Limited English Proficiency is a key determinant of these barriers, yet little is known about how older, LEP patients experience communication from general practice. AIM:To identify the experiences and preferences for communication from Australian general practice by older Greek patients with limited English proficiency. DESIGN & SETTING:An exploratory, qualitative, descriptive research design was used. The study took place in a Greek community club in South-East Melbourne. METHOD:Ten older Greek persons with limited English proficiency and two informal carers were interviewed in a mix of both English and Greek. Interviews lasted 20-45 minutes, were audio-recorded, transcribed verbatim, and translated to English. Data were analysed using reflexive thematic analysis. RESULTS:Participants described diverse experiences, three themes emerged: 1) The 'good doctor' and 'good clinic': being a person or place that provides them with a range of communication modalities tailored to their needs, is comfortable and accessible, and provides essential health services on-site; 2) Communication experiences with healthcare professionals, including the communication methods used and the reasons for their use; and 3) The diverse range of preferences for communication, particularly in relation to technology, which were often due to their age and English proficiency. CONCLUSION:The preferences and needs for communication from general practice clinics amongst this group was influenced by age and language related factors. It is important to consider these factors when designing, and implementing communication systems in general practice.
OBJECTIVES:Despite evidence and guidelines supporting rehabilitation, people with dementia experience limited access due to health professionals' attitudes, knowledge gaps, and systemic barriers. The INCLUDE package is an interdisciplinary online training programme and Community of Practice (CoP) designed to address these barriers. The aim of this study was to evaluate the impact of the INCLUDE package on health professionals' knowledge, attitudes, confidence, advocacy, and practice change in dementia rehabilitation. METHODS:A pre-post longitudinal study involved two groups of health professionals across Australia. Group 1 (n = 103) completed the online training and an 8-month CoP; Group 2 (n = 373) completed training only. Surveys administered at pre-training (T1), post-training (T2), and 10-month follow-up (T3; Group 1 only) assessed knowledge, attitudes and confidence towards dementia and dementia rehabilitation. Multilevel mixed-effects regression models were used to examine changes over time. Content analysis was used to explore advocacy, practice changes, barriers, and sustainability. RESULTS:476 health professionals participated. The largest groups were physiotherapists (n = 121, 26.7%), occupational therapists (n = 120, 26.5%) and nurses (n = 37,13.6%). The Dementia Attitudes Scale (coefficient 10.4, 95% CI 9.4-11.4), Dementia Rehabilitation Questionnaire (3.8, 95% CI 3.0-4.5), and Confidence in Delivering Dementia Rehabilitation Scale (3.2, 95% CI 2.8-3.5) improved from T1 to T2. In Group 1, improvements in attitudes towards dementia and confidence in rehabilitation were sustained at T3, but knowledge and attitudes towards dementia rehabilitation declined from T2 to T3. Participants advocated for dementia rehabilitation and made changes in their workplace including revising rehabilitation access criteria, advertising dementia rehabilitation to referrers, and developing interdisciplinary programs. CONCLUSIONS:The INCLUDE package improved health professionals' attitudes, knowledge and confidence in dementia rehabilitation. Although participants made changes in their workplace, barriers still existed. Organisational and system-level changes are also required to improve access to dementia rehabilitation. TRIAL REGISTRATION:This study is registered with the Australian New Zealand Clinical Trials Registry: ACTRN12623001029684.
OBJECTIVE:To examine changes in rates of primary care patients seeing multiple prescribers and characteristics of patients who ceased seeing multiple prescribers for monitored medicines after voluntary implementation of the Victorian prescription drug monitoring program (PDMP). STUDY DESIGN:Controlled interrupted time series analysis of primary care electronic medical records. SETTING:A total of 562 general practices across three Victorian healthcare networks (Monash Health, Peninsula Health, Eastern Health). PATIENTS:People prescribed at least one PDMP-monitored medicine (e.g., opioids, benzodiazepines) and/or non-monitored psychotropic medicines (e.g., antidepressants, antipsychotics) between 1 January 2017 and 30 June 2023. INTERVENTION:Voluntary (1 April 2019) and mandatory (1 April 2020) implementation of the Victorian PDMP. MAIN OUTCOME MEASURES:Changes in the monthly rate of people seeing multiple prescribers (defined as four or more prescribers) following PDMP implementation for monitored medicines, with non-monitored medicines used as a control; characteristics of people who ceased seeing multiple prescribers for monitored medicines following PDMP implementation. RESULTS:Following voluntary PDMP implementation (1 April 2019), there was a significant reduction in the differential step and trend changes in the rates of seeing multiple prescribers between people prescribed monitored and non-monitored medicines (differential step change: β, -3.55 [95% confidence interval (CI), -5.08 to -2.03]; differential trend change: β, -0.29 [95% CI, -0.46 to -0.12]). Following mandatory PDMP implementation (1 April 2020), there was no significant step change difference. However, there was an increase in the differential trend change in the rate of seeing multiple prescribers between those prescribed monitored and non-monitored medicines (differential trend change: β, 0.21 [95% CI, 0.05-0.37]; p = 0.009). Logistic regression revealed that older age (95% CI, 1.39-1.75), male gender (95% CI, 1.09-1.25), metropolitan residence (95% CI, 1.04 and 1.23) and substance use disorder diagnosis (95% CI, 1.07-1.28) were associated with significantly higher odds of seeing multiple prescribers before PDMP implementation. CONCLUSIONS:Implementation of the PDMP was associated with meaningful reductions in people accessing monitored medicines from four or more prescribers.
Primary aldosteronism (PA) is a common and treatable cause of hypertension, affecting up to 15% of patients in primary care, yet it remains substantially underdiagnosed. Recent international guidelines recommend routine screening for PA in all individuals with hypertension, highlighting the need for effective implementation strategies in general practice. We aim to determine whether an electronic clinical decision support (eCDS) tool integrated into general practice software improves PA screening and diagnosis. CONSEP (CONn Syndrome screening and Evaluation in Primary care) is a pragmatic cluster randomised controlled trial conducted in general practices across three Australian states. Practices will be block-randomised by size and location (state) in a 1:1 ratio to intervention (eCDS) or control. Patients eligible for analysis will be adults with hypertension attending participating practices. De-identified data will be extracted from clinical software at baseline, 12 months, and 24 months. Analyses will follow intention-to-treat principles using regression models accounting for clustering at the practice level. Primary outcomes are the proportion of patients screened for PA within 12 months and the proportion diagnosed with PA within 24 months. Secondary outcomes include blood pressure control, antihypertensive medication burden, cost-effectiveness, and a process evaluation assessing acceptability, feasibility, and sustainability. By embedding guideline-based screening into routine workflows, this trial addresses a major evidence-practice gap in hypertension care. If effective, the intervention could improve hypertension management, increase detection of PA, and reduce long-term cardiovascular risk in primary care.
BACKGROUND:Health-related quality of life is central to healthy ageing, yet gender differences among older adults and their underlying determinants are not well understood. We examined gender differences in quality of life in a large cohort of older Australians and the extent to which biopsychosocial factors mediate these differences. METHODS:We analysed baseline cross-sectional data from the Statins in Reducing Events in the Elderly trial, a randomised controlled trial of community-dwelling Australians aged ≥70 years without cardiovascular disease, major physical disability, or dementia. Quality of life was measured across eight domains of the 36-Item Short Form and summarised using the SF-6D index. Gender differences were examined using age-adjusted linear regression, with mediation assessed by the percentage reduction in the association between gender and quality of life after adjusting for individual biopsychosocial factors. RESULTS:Among 9971 participants (52% women; mean age 74.7 ± 4.5 years), women scored lower than men in Physical Functioning, Vitality, Mental Health, and Bodily Pain (all p < 0.001), but higher in General Health (p < 0.001). The SF-6D index was lower in women (mean difference - 0.03, p < 0.001). Pain severity, depressive symptoms, and histories of osteoarthritis and depression mediated the greatest amount of the gender difference in scores (between 42% and 92%). CONCLUSIONS:Older women reported better general health but poorer quality of life than men in most domains. These gender differences were largely attributable to pain and depressive symptoms, both of which are common and modifiable. Targeted management of these symptoms may improve quality of life and reduce gender disparities in later life.
Evidence shows that patient outcomes following musculoskeletal injury have been associated with the timing of care. Despite the increasing number of injured workers presenting with low back pain (LBP) in primary care, little is known about the factors that are associated with the timing of initial healthcare provider visits. This study investigated factors that are associated with the timing of initial workers’ compensation (WC)-funded care provider visits for LBP claims. We used a retrospective cohort design. A standardised multi-jurisdiction database of LBP claims with injury dates from July 2011 to June 2015 was analysed. Determinants of the time to initial general practitioner (GPs) and or musculoskeletal (MSK) therapists were investigated using an accelerated failure time model, with a time ratio (TR) > 1 indicating a longer time to initial healthcare provider visit. 9088 LBP claims were included. The median time to first healthcare provider visit was 3 days (interquartile range (IQR) 1–9). Compared to General practitioners (GPs) (median 3 days, IQR 1–8), the timing of initial consultation was longer if the first healthcare providers were MSK therapists (median 5 days, IQR 2–14) (p < 0.001). BACKGROUND:Early physical therapy for workers reporting low back pain (LBP) may reduce disability and improve return to work. This study aimed to explore the relationship between the timing of physical therapy commencement and the duration of work disability after the onset of compensable LBP. METHODS:We conducted a retrospective cohort analysis of workers with workers' compensation claims for LBP in two Australian states. We investigated the association between the timing of physical therapy commencement and work disability duration using an accelerated failure time model. Median duration of work disability in paid calendar weeks was the principal outcome. RESULTS:We examined 9160 accepted workers' compensation claims for LBP. Patients who had not seen a physical therapist had the shortest duration of disability (median, 4.1 weeks). In those who had seen a physical therapist, the median duration of work disability was associated with the timing of commencement of physical therapy, from 8.0 weeks for care within 7 days of the injury to 34.7 weeks when care was commenced greater than 30 days after the onset of injury. Our adjusted model demonstrated that, compared to physical therapy within 7 days of injury onset, commencement of physical therapy between 8 and 14 days, 15 and 30 days, and greater than 30 days was associated with a 37.0% (Time ratios (TR) 1.37; 95% CI (1.23, 1.52)), 119% (TR 2.19; 95% CI (1.96, 2.44)) and 315% (TR 4.51; 95% CI (4.06, 5.02)) increased likelihood of longer disability duration, respectively. CONCLUSIONS:In workers with work-related LBP undertaking physical therapy, early commencement of physical therapy was associated with a significantly shorter duration of disability. Although we cannot establish causality, our findings highlight the potential benefits of initiatives that promote timely initiation of treatment in reducing extended work disability for injured workers undergoing physical therapy for LBP.
